UK CHARTS: LEGO Batman 2 makes it three in a row

It’s three weeks and counting at the top of the UKIE GfK Chart-Track All Formats Top 40 for Warner Interactive’s LEGO Batman 2: DC Super Heroes.

Hot on its heels, though, is Sega’s London 2012: The Official Video Game, which enjoys a sales jump of 81 per cent to climb two places to second.

Activision’s The Amazing Spider-Man and 2K Games’ Spec Ops: The Line both slip a place to third and fourth respectively, with Koch media’s Dead Island: Game of the Year Edition debuting at No.5.

Square Enix’s 3DS title Theatrhythm: Final Fantasy makes its charts bow in 19th with EA’s shooting MMO The Secret World managing 38th in its first week.

Here’s the UK Top 20 for the week ending July 7th:

1. LEGO Batman 2: DC Super Heroes (Warner Bros)
2. London 2012: The Official Video Game (Sega)
3. The Amazing Spider-Man (Activision)
4. Spec Ops: The Line (2K Games)
5. Dead Island Game of the Year Edition (Koch Media)
6. The Elder Scrolls V: Skyrim (Bethesda)
7. FIFA 12 (EA)
8. Call of Duty: Modern Warfare 3 (Activision)
9. Ghost Recon: Future Soldier (Ubisoft)
10. FIFA Street (EA)
11. Mario & Sonic at the London 2012 Olympic Games (Sega)
12. Sniper Elite V2 (505 Games)
13. Max Payne 3 (Rockstar)
14. Batman: Arkham City (Warner Bros)
15. Battlefield 3 (EA)
16. Call of Duty: Black Ops (Activision)
17. Mass Effect 3 (EA)
18. Assassin’s Creed: Revelations (Ubisoft)
19. Theatrhythm: Final Fantasy (Square Enix)
20. Halo Combat Evolved: Anniversary (Microsoft)
